Transaction 58ca2ff3d70ea187611643e22efcb0b32fd5e9699dd69dc132fe175ae38aa7cf
1 Input
2 Outputs
- 58ca2ff3d70ea187611643e22efcb0b32fd5e9699dd69dc132fe175ae38aa7cf:0
- 58ca2ff3d70ea187611643e22efcb0b32fd5e9699dd69dc132fe175ae38aa7cf:1
value 1059200
address 15fbCkAoi4pxW5buTkRJLm4E1PUD22umV6
value 48961052
address 1BhhkrHhWgRZWzijkK417PcxiR8mXe7mLn